Your data is transmitted over the internet between your computer and mine using TLS encryption. TLS stands for "Transport Layer Security" and is an encryption protocol for data transmission on the internet. You can usually recognize TLS by the closed padlock icon in your browser's address bar and the address beginning with https://.

I use cookies to make using my website easier and better. Cookies are small pieces of text information that can be stored on your computer or smartphone via your browser when you visit a website. This allows the website to recognize returning visitors. Cookies can also provide me with information about how you use my website, so I can continuously improve its design.
Cookies themselves do not contain any personal data about users; they serve only to uniquely identify what my customers find interesting and useful on my website. I also use so-called "web beacons" (small graphic images, also known as "pixel tags" or "clear GIFs") on my website. These are used in conjunction with cookies to track general user behavior on the website.

I use a technique called local storage, also known as "local data" or "local memory." This means that data is stored locally in your browser's web cache, and this data remains even after you close the browser window or exit the program—unless you clear the cache. No connection to a server is established.

You have the right under Article 15 Paragraph 1 GDPR to request, free of charge INFORMATION TO RECEIVE INFORMATION ABOUT THE PERSONAL DATA STORED ABOUT YOU. FURTHERMORE, IF THE LAW REQUIREMENTS ARE MET, YOU HAVE A RIGHT TO CORRECTION (ART. 16 GDPR), DELETION (ART. 17 GDPR) AND RESTRICTION The processing (Art. 18 GDPR) of your personal data. If you have provided the processed data yourself, you have a right to data portability pursuant to Art. 20 GDPR.
If the data processing is based on Article 6(1)(e) or (f) of the GDPR, you have the right to object pursuant to Article 21 of the GDPR. If you object to data processing, it will cease in the future unless the controller can demonstrate compelling legitimate grounds for the processing which override the data subject's interest in objecting.
IF THE DATA PROCESSING IS BASED ON CONSENT PURSUANT TO ART. 6 PARA. 1 LIT. A), ART. 9 PARA. 2 LIT. A) OR ART. 49 PARA. 1 LIT. A) GDPR, YOU MAY REVOKE YOUR CONSENT AT ANY TIME WITH EFFECT FOR THE FUTURE, WITHOUT AFFECTING THE LAW OF THE PROCESSING UNTIL PREVIOUSLY.
Furthermore, you have the right to lodge a complaint with a data protection supervisory authority. In particular, the complaint can be lodged with a supervisory authority of the EU member state of your place of residence, workplace, or the place of the alleged infringement.
